Output bd44d750faf97a123cc367a8b60f09bb3614bd2f0158e44bba505f6a6ff732ec:31

value
425070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aac9eb922f29f2a604905e051a7a12fc38088a3 OP_EQUAL
address
3P5rqHEsssLwzMpDdhuf6C39g6YKMWqFWw
transaction
bd44d750faf97a123cc367a8b60f09bb3614bd2f0158e44bba505f6a6ff732ec
confirmations
20531
spent
true